Problem with heat pressing a design
NatDragon replied to krys10g's topic in T-Shirts and/ or Garments
This I have done a lot of. Like the others suggested, if they are old this will happen. If not, the shirts have to be pre-heated, rolled for fuzzys, then applied with a teflon sheet or parchment paper to avoid scorching. What kind of shirts are you using? You are not washing them first are you? Good luck! I feel your frustration! Let us know if you solve the problem with another remedy. -

Ink from inkjet printers is transparent so if you apply to a dark shirt it doesn't show. You need the white backing for the ink to show. Laser is not transparent. I have done a lot of inkjet transfers, I agree with CBS 1963 about JetPro Sofstretch, it is good. I have also done laser transfers, but have not found a paper that I really like. I must admit my laser is only for letter size while my inkjet prints 13" X 19" which means I can gang print, so I haven't made a huge effort to find great laser transfer paper. I am just learning how to do heat vinyl on shirts. I have moved in this direction because I am just not happy with inkjet results on darks.
